- 337 名前:335 mailto:sage [2008/06/04(水) 00:57:48 ]
- 補足
PROGRAM NAN IMPLICIT NONE REAL(4) :: a REAL(8) :: d a = TRANSFER(-1_4, a) d = TRANSFER(-1_8, d) PRINT *, a, d STOP END PROGRAM NAN 実行結果 by Intel Fortran NaN NaN Press any key to continue . . . ここで -1_4 と -1_8 はそれぞれ4バイトと8バイトの整数の -1 。 2の補数表現なので整数の -1 は全ビット立ってる。
|

|